For week 5, Stan and I decided to continue our collaborations that have happened for the past two weeks. We showed up to SITE at 7:00 on a dark, cold, rainy evening. We knew that we desire sound-making materials, but we were unsure what to use. This is when I discovered two plastic covers to plumbing fixtures in the corner of the park. Their name escapes me, but they are rectangular with rounded corners and about a foot long. We proceeded to kick and throw these down the street parallel to the park. When we got to a dead end, Stan noticed a traffic cone that had been in front of a house since our class began. He picked it up and began to make sound with it as well. We kicked, threw and banged on these elements all the way to a dumpster in front of an apartment complex. This is where our performance ended. Stan said it best – we were like two punk kids.
